Apple exceeded $10 billion in annual sales in India for the first time last fiscal year, underscoring surging demand for its pricey devices in a market where it’s steadily ramping up its retail network. Apple’s iPhone lineup accounted for a significant majority of the sales, while demand for iPads and MacBooks also rose, the person said.
